Melatonin - What Is It Made Of?
What Is It Made Of?
Melatonin is a hormone found naturally in the human body, in other animals, in certain plants, and even in some foods. It is made from tryptophan (TRIP-tuh-fan), an essential amino acidAn amino acid that is only found in food; amino acids make up proteins.. When tryptophan is ingested, the body turns it into serotonin that is then made into melatonin. The pineal gland is the primary location for melatonin production but the retina and intestines make small amounts as well.
Melatonin supplements are either synthetic (human-made) or natural (contain animal products). They are chemically identical to the melatonin that is produced by the human body. Some people think that using the natural melatonin, typically made from the pineal glands of animals such as sheep, run a greater risk of being contaminated by a virus. Therefore, the synthetic version is the most recommended and most popular form of melatonin. However, since the FDA does not regulate it, one can never be sure of the effectiveness, purity, or safety of the supplement.
As a supplement, melatonin consists of much higher amounts of the hormone than are naturally secreted at any one time in the body. A single dose is usually 500 micrograms to 5 milligrams per dose, more than 10 times higher than what is normal in the human body.
Studies have not shown the high doses cause greater benefit or greater risk to the body. However, a doctor should be consulted before taking any supplement.
Age Factors
Before reaching puberty, children create the largest amounts of melatonin, with the highest levels between the ages of four and seven. At puberty, melatonin production begins to slow down and gradually decreases to an average of about 30 micrograms per day. Some researchers suggest that the decrease in the level of melatonin at puberty may be related to the fact that the child is maturing sexually.
Research findings have been inconsistent about whether or not melatonin continues to diminish with age. A number of scientists believe that melatonin production decreases as the body ages, which might explain why elderly people have greater sleep problems. However, a study by Dr. J. B. Fourtillan, published in the January 2001 issue of American Journal of Physiology, indicated that the levels of melatonin did not differ between a group of 34 healthy adults over age 65 and a group of 101 healthy adults under age 30.
